Gestion de Contenu, de Communauté et de groupes de travail collaboratif - Open Source, français, sécurisé, stable et performant

  • MODULES

    Pour étendre les nombreuses fonctionnalités disponibles de base - modules.npds.org est à votre disposition.

    Des modules complémentaires, une communauté de développeurs active, des forums pour vos questions ... NPDS  est aussi une plateforme de développement !
  • STYLES

    Vous cherchez des thèmes graphiques pour votre portail ou votre communauté : styles.npds.org est à votre disposition.

    Des thèmes du plus simple au plus sophistiqué. Des thèmes facilement modifiables et toujours en Open-Source - Laissez simplement parler votre imagination !
  • BIBLES

    La documentation indispensable pour personnaliser et exploiter toute la puissante de NPDS  est à votre disposition sur bible.npds.org.

    Vous pouvez participer à l'effort de documentation - rien de plus simple : contactez un membre de la Team de développement et nous vous ouvrirons un compte sur le Wiki !
Devenir membre    |    Identifiant : Mot de Passe : -
Au delà de la gestion de contenu 'classique', NPDS met en oeuvre un ensemble de fonctions spécifiquement dédiées à la gestion de Communauté et de groupes de travail collaboratif.
Il s'agit d'un Content & Community Management System (CCMS) robuste, sécurisé, complet, performant et parlant vraiment français.

Gérez votre Communauté d'utilisateurs, vos groupes de travail collaboratif, publiez, gérez et organisez votre contenu grâce aux puissants outils disponibles de base.
  • Multi langues (Français, Anglais, Allemand, Espagnol, Chinois)
  • Respect des standards : UTF8, XHTML, CSS, ...
  • Système de blocs avancés
  • Installation et administration complète et centralisée
  • Editeur HTML intégré
  • Gestionnaire de fichier en ligne
  • Gestion des groupes de membres
  • Ecriture collaborative de documents (PAD)
  • Forums évolués
  • Mini-sites (pour les membres et les groupes de travail)
  • Chat temp réel
  • Système de News et de rubriques complet (édition, révision, publication)
  • ...
Gratuit et libre (Open-Source), développé en PHP, NPDS est personnalisable grâce à de nombreux thèmes et modules et ne requiert que quelques compétences de base.
NPDS Workplace - groupe de travail collaboratif
 NPDS WorkSpace - tous l'univers du travail collaboratif.
Patchs de correction de sécurité
Posté par : root le 30 août 2022

Rechercher dans NPDS

Un de nos membres @Nosp (que nous remercions vivement) a effectué une revue de sécurité de NPDS version 16.3.
Cette revue met en lumière 3 faiblesses affectant TOUTES les versions du CMS.

Nous vous proposons un premier correctif qui "ferme" les 2 principaux problèmes et ceci pour les versions NPDS de 13 à 16.3.
=>Globalement ces corrections se traduisent par la modification de certains fichiers du chat, et un renforcement du contrôle des url via grab_globals.php.

La dernière faiblesse (de niveau moyen/faible) sera quand a elle corrigée dans la 16.4 en cours de développement.

Merci de consulter le fichier patch2022.txt pour faire les corrections nécessaires / un kit est également en préparation pour les version 13 et 16

Merci de vos retours et n'hésitez pas en cas de question de doute à poster dans le forum...

@jpb et @dev

 


www.npds.org Commentaires ? | Page Spéciale pour impression   Envoyer cet Article à un ami

infocapagde.com en version 16.4 dev !
Posté par : jpb le 25 avril 2022

Rechercher dans Infos, News

Infocapagde utilise le CMS NPDS depuis 2002, il a connu toutes nos évolutions. Il fonctionnait en v.16.0.3-beta jusqu'en mars dernier. Avec la complicité de jpb, il est le premier site (avec le labo de développement) en production sous la version de développement REvolution 16.4 qui est la version la plus aboutie du CMS.

Le site se trouve donc maintenant à la pointe des développements npds, ce résultat devrait inviter tous les fidèles utilisateurs de npds à adopter la version 16.3 voire cette  version 16.4 déjà très stable du CMS.

Bonne découverte et merci de vos retours !

 

infocap.jpg

 

 

Note : "

Bô boulot !  (Cette version 16.4 encore en développement devrait sortir à l'automne prochain ! ...)

"

www.npds.org 1 Commentaire | Page Spéciale pour impression   Envoyer cet Article à un ami

Le site pharmechange.com est passé en 16.3
Posté par : fliaigre le 06 février 2022

Rechercher dans Infos, News

Pharmechange est né il y a presque 20 ans d’une idée toute simple : les gens de ma profession sont répartis dans plus de 23 000 entreprises et échangent peu ou pas. Il s’agit de la pharmacie d’officine.

Vous comprenez bien que l’officine et l’informatique, surtout il y a 20 ans, ce n’était pas évident. J’avais fait quelques pas en pages html, mais je cherchais une solution plus interactive.

Au fil de mes recherches je suis tombé par hasard sur NPDS, une communauté française dirigée par un mec inspiré et efficace le grand Developpeur qui proposait un CMS qui me semblait correspondre à ce que je voulais faire.

 

pharmexange.jpg

Note : "

@filaigre du bô boulot un site moderne propre et sobre ...

"

www.npds.org Lire la suite... 3 267 caractères de plus | 2 Commentaires | Page Spéciale pour impression   Envoyer cet Article à un ami

UsbWebServer 8-6-2 et NPDS WS 16.3
Posté par : bartok le 03 janvier 2022

Rechercher dans NPDS

 

Cette mise-à-jour du kit proposé fin 2013 par colonelwog, supporte maintenant PHP/7.1.11, MySQL/5.6.34 et Apache/2.4.29 (win32) et permet l’exécution, sur une clé USB en mode ‘portable’, de NPDS REvolution 16.3

 ws16-3.jpg

 Il est ainsi possible d’élaborer, de tester puis de maintenir sa gestion de contenu, en local, sous windows, sans recourir obligatoirement à un hébergement en ligne.

Pour ce faire, il suffit de déposer puis de décompresser dans la racine d’une clé USB, préalablement formatée (FAT32), le fichier UsbWebServer8-6-2_REv16-3_Full.zip, disponible dans la zone de téléchargement.

 Télécharger ICI

Tout est prêt à fonctionner (code et base de données).

L’archive contient également une documentation relative à l’installation, au fonctionnement d’UsbWebServer ainsi qu’à la mise en place des versions futures de REv16.

Note : "

@Bartok merci pour la continuité du suivi !

"

www.npds.org 5 Commentaires | Page Spéciale pour impression   Envoyer cet Article à un ami

REvolution 16.3
Posté par : jpb le 22 décembre 2021

Rechercher dans NPDS

Voici donc la nouvelle version de notre CMS préféré !

A télécharger ICI

Source code (zip)

Source code (tar.gz)


Outre les nombreuses corrections, stabilisations et mise à jour de dépendances on peut signaler quatre évolutions majeures en terme de performance, communication et sécurité :

Un nouveau système de cryptage des mots de passe complètement transparent pour les webmasters et les utilisateurs ...

Des alertes et notifications provenant de npds permettront une communication directe depuis la team de développement npds vers les administrateurs de portail.

Un traitement fin des images "data:image en base64" permet enfin de s'adapter aux techniques employé par les médias portables, et par l'éditeur tiny...

La généralisation de l'utilisation de l'attribut loading pour les images et les iframes permet un gain de vitesse considérable sur le chargement et l'affichage des pages...

Voir plus bas pour des explications un peu plus complètes et encore plus loin pour le changelog détaillé !

Alors, découvrez cette nouvelle version, en passant de bonne fêtes de fin d'année et pas d'excès ! Et merci pour vos futurs retours d'expérience, ils seront les bienvenus.

Concocté by : @jpb, @npdsutilisateur, @nicolas2, @Dev 

 


www.npds.org Lire la suite... 4 247 caractères de plus | 2 Commentaires | Page Spéciale pour impression   Envoyer cet Article à un ami

Happy Birthday NPDS 20 ans !
Posté par : jpb le 02 juin 2021

Rechercher dans NPDS

Quand on regarde le code source de nos scripts voilà ce que l'on y trouve :

/* NPDS Copyright (c) 2001-2021 by Philippe Brunier */

! 20 ans déjà !

20 ans déjà que sortait la version 4.7 ...! Rare sont les projets opensource durable dans le temps, NPDS bon an mal an a quand même réussi à s'adapter aux évolutions impitoyables des languages et des technologies du web qui condamnent tous projets qui n'auraient pas évolués.

A l'heure de l'apologie des grands réseaux sociaux on peut se demander si un CMS comme NPDS a encore une place dans ce virevoltant monde du web ?

- Que sont ces gigantesques réseaux sociaux à quoi servent ils ?
- Sur le web où se trouvent les contenus leur réalité, leur véracité, leur accessibilité ?

Alors oui, en réfléchissant à ces questions je n'ai pas de doute les CMS, CCMS gardent toute leur place, elle est petite mais elle existe !

Merci @Dev, toutes les équipes de développement successives et les participants, pour le temps consacré à ce projet et d'en avoir fait ce qu'il est aujourd'hui !

 

Alors souhaitons nous bon anniversaire NPDS !

 

PS : Et en cadeau la 16.3 avec de belles améliorations est dans les starting blocks ...


www.npds.org 15 Commentaires | Page Spéciale pour impression   Envoyer cet Article à un ami

UsbWebServer 8-6-2 et NPDS REvolution 16.2.1
Posté par : bartok le 13 mars 2021

Rechercher dans Infos, News

 

ws1621.jpg 

Pour mémoire, UsbWebServer est un émulateur de serveur http fonctionnant uniquement sous windows. (1) Il a été adapté pour NPDS par colonelwog avec l’appui de dev, à l’occasion de la sortie de NPDS WS11 et permet d’installer NPDS sur un disque ou - mieux encore - sur une clé USB afin d’élaborer, de tester et de maintenir ses gestions de contenu sans recourir obligatoirement à un hébergement en ligne. A noter que la version 16.2 (et suivantes) de NPDS ne peuvent pas fonctionner sur l’hébergeur gratuit Free tant qu'il n'y aura pas un upgrade vers une version de mysql supportant utf8mb4.

A la suite de la diffusion récente du patch de sécurité inclus dans la version WS16.2.1 de NPDS, deux possibilités s’offrent à vous pour en bénéficier en local:

1- La version 8-6-2 d’usbwebserver est déjà installée sur votre disque / clé USB :

# téléchargez le zip dans l’espace de téléchargement du portail npds.org

http://www.npds.org/download.php?op=mydown&did=196

# créez un sous-répertoire dans usbwebserver/root/ (ie WS16-2-1)

# dézippez-y le fichier téléchargé

# suivez les consignes figurant dans le fichier lisez-moi.pdf pour terminer l’installation de NPDS WS16-2-1.

2- Vous n’avez pas encore installé usbwebserver 8-6-2 :

# téléchargez le zip dans l’espace de téléchargement du portail npds.org

http://www.npds.org/download.php?op=mydown&did=198

# Pour installer, suivez les consignes figurant dans le fichier lisez- moi.pdf

# Dans le répertoire usbwebserver/root/ vous trouverez trois sous- dossiers dans lesquels NPDS est prêt à l’emploi :

* WS13

* WS 16-1

* WS 16-2-1

Les deux premiers vous permettront de tester en local le passage (iso ou utf8) vers utf8mb4 qui est le charset de NPDS WS 16.2.1 et ultérieures.

 

(1) Il existe d’autres alternatives comme XAMPP et WAMPSERVER sous windows, WAMP sous Mac-OS ou LAMP sous linux.

Note : "

@bartok merci pour la réactivité !

"

www.npds.org Commentaires ? | Page Spéciale pour impression   Envoyer cet Article à un ami

Patch de sécurité
Posté par : jpb le 07 mars 2021

Rechercher dans NPDS

Bonjour

Voici donc et ce n'est pas coutume un patch de sécurité répondant au problème décrit sommairement ci-dessous.

Il est disponible ici ghostform-patch-secu.txt

Au vu de la nature du problème nous vous conseillons fortement d'appliquer ce patch sur tous vos sites.

Problème :
sécurité

Description
création compte utilisateur hors de contrôle

Versions concernées TOUTES :
de 4.7 à 16.2 et très probablement toutes les versions antiques ...

Niveau :
sérieux

Fichier concerné :
user.php

 

NB : l'url de votre site doit être parfaitement renseigné dans vos préférences !


www.npds.org 5 Commentaires | Page Spéciale pour impression   Envoyer cet Article à un ami

Page Suivante

Temps : 0.056 seconde(s)